Gunns holds EGM


10 September 2003

HOBART — The Wilderness Society’s “corporate campaign” against woodchipping company Gunns Ltd resulted in an extraordinary general meeting of the company on August 29. A motion calling on the company to stop woodchipping in high-conservation forests, as identified through Tasmania Together process, was unsuccessful. However, three large corporate shareholders abstained in the vote. Pictured is an August 19 rally in Hobart supporting the campaign.
